Wide-format choices matter. Wide-format supplies vary by width, weight, and core size, and those choices affect every transfer. Pick materials that match your printer to avoid feeding issues and to keep colors true.
The SPP85100 is an 8.5" x 100' option with a 3" core and 31 lb stock weight. It fits many wide-format machines and is ideal for long, continuous runs.
The A-SUB 105gsm option comes in 13" x 110' or 13" x 300'. Choose the longer length when you want fewer roll changes for banners or multiple garments.
Core size matters. A 3" core is common for professional printers; some equipment needs a 2" core. Confirm your spindle size before buying.

A hybrid adhesive layer that activates at 131 degrees helps keep designs perfectly aligned and vivid. This tacky technology grips textiles to prevent ghosting during the transfer process.
High-grade stock is engineered so ink stays on the surface rather than soaking in. That design produces richer color and sharper detail with every press.

Start calm and check alignment. Load media straight into the top feeder and confirm the sensor detects the leading edge before you press print. Small misreads can halt a long job or cause the design to feed crooked.
Prevent feeding issues: use the correct core size for your model and support the roll so it doesn't curl away from the Epson 2800 sensor. If the material won't sit flat, try tightening the spool or switching to a different core.
Always load the printable side toward the printheads and set the right color profile. That reduces faded edges and helps achieve a clean transfer.

Yes. You can buy transfer media in rolls that fit wide-format printers. Rolls are convenient for long runs and large designs, and they work well with continuous-feed printers and manual heat presses when trimmed to size.
Roll widths commonly range from 13 inches up to 60 inches, with lengths sold by the yard or in large spools (10–100 meters). Choose a width that matches your printer's printable area and your item size to reduce waste and trim time.
Core diameter must match your printer or unwinder. Most desktop-compatible rolls use a 1–3 inch core, while industrial systems use 2–6 inch cores. Check your printer specs or accessory compatibility before buying.
Rolls improve throughput, reduce handling for long jobs, and minimize seams on continuous prints. They also help maintain consistent color across large runs and cut down on paper waste compared with single-sheet workflows.
Use the correct media profile for your printer and ink set, ensure even tension on the roll, and let the media relax before printing. Keep feed paths clean and avoid sharp bends that can cause skewing or micro-jams.
Some desktop printers accept narrow rolls or can be fitted with roll-feed adapters. Verify the printer manual for roll-feed support and confirm the core size and maximum width first.
Store rolls flat or upright in a cool, dry place away from direct sunlight. Keep them in the original packaging until use and avoid high humidity to prevent curling and coating degradation.
Rolls let you produce continuous, wide graphics that suit large garments, banners, and wraps. For curved or narrow items like mugs, trim the roll into sheets sized for consistent heat press coverage and transfer time.
Yes. Coating chemistry and basis weight change ink absorption, color vibrancy, and drying time. Lighter bases feed more easily but may curl; heavier bases resist tearing and work better for high-temperature transfers.

Calibrate your printer, use ICC profiles for your ink and media, and run nozzle checks regularly. High-quality inks and consistent tension reduce banding and keep color consistent across the page.
Generally, yes. Rolls often lower per-foot cost and minimize waste for continuous jobs. Factor in your typical page sizes and printer efficiency to compare price-per-print accurately.
Many third-party supplies work well, but compatibility varies. Check vendor data sheets and user reviews. Using recommended media profiles and keeping firmware updated helps avoid feed and color issues.
Use a rotary cutter, straightedge, or guillotine designed for large-format materials. A table with a clean, flat surface and clamps keeps the page aligned and prevents jagged edges that can jam printers.
Match transfer time and temperature to the substrate, use a quality heat press or wrap jig for curved items, and conduct small test transfers. Proper pressure and dwell time preserve fine detail and color fidelity.
